What are the typical duties performed by someone on Bridge Watch during a voyage?

During a voyage, Bridge Watch personnel are responsible for continuously monitoring the vessel’s position, maintaining a proper lookout, and ensuring safe navigation according to established routes and maritime regulations. They communicate with other crew members and external contacts, assist with course changes, record navigational data, and operate critical navigational and safety equipment as needed. The role often involves working in shifts to guarantee 24/7 vigilance, especially in busy shipping lanes or challenging weather conditions. Teamwork and communication with the captain, officers, and other crew are critical to ensure all navigational decisions are executed safely and efficiently.

What is a Bridge Watch job?

A Bridge Watch job involves monitoring a vessel's navigation and safety while on duty on the ship's bridge. Responsibilities include keeping a lookout for obstacles, assisting with navigation, maintaining communication with the crew, and following maritime regulations. This role is critical to ensuring safe passage and operational efficiency. Bridge Watch personnel typically work under the supervision of the officer on watch. Training and certification requirements vary by country and vessel type.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Bridge Watch position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Bridge Watch, you need solid knowledge of maritime navigation, situational awareness, and understanding of safety protocols, commonly backed by merchant marine training or relevant certifications. Familiarity with radar, GPS, communication equipment, and bridge management systems is essential for effective vessel monitoring and operation. Attention to detail, teamwork, and the ability to remain calm under pressure are strong assets in this role. These skills are critical because Bridge Watch personnel are responsible for the safe navigation of vessels and ensuring the safety of crew, cargo, and the vessel itself at all times.

In the role of Rail Bridge Engineer, we'll count on you to: 

Apply structural engineering and detailing techniques to support the development of bid plans for railroad bridges, retaining walls, box culverts and associated railroad structures. Analysis, design, and detailing will be included. Daily activities may also include utilizing conventional AREMA bridge engineering design procedures, performing structural calculations, assisting with geometric layout, developing structural details, and using specialized software such as LARSA, MathCAD, LEAPBridge (CONSPAN), LPile, FB MultiPier and MicroStation. It is also expected that this person will assign, supervise, and review work and/or check design calculations, plans, estimates and specifications produced by junior engineers and Bridge EITs. Occasional bridge inspections of in-service bridges, or bridge construction, may be required. Concurrent project management, and task management, of smaller projects may also be included.
